Abu Dhabi, UAE – Fakhr Al Watan Office confirmed that the UAE continues to establish an integrated national system based on readiness and proactiveness.
In addition to empowering the heroes of the first line of defense as they are the basic pillar for protecting the health of society.
The office explained that the efficiency achieved by the UAE in confronting health challenges is the result of a strategic vision invested in qualifying cadres.
In addition to building capabilities and developing response systems, ensuring the best performance during crises and epidemics.
He said: “We are proud of our heroes who have formed and continue to form the first line of defense for society, and of a national system that has made continuous training and comprehensive support a solid approach to ensuring their readiness in various circumstances”.
He pointed out that the UAE not only supports national efforts, but also continues to support regional and international efforts aimed at preventing infectious diseases and epidemics.
In addition to mitigating and treating its effects, in line with the 2030 Agenda, and enhancing global health cooperation.
Fakhr Al Watan office stressed that investing in people will remain the cornerstone of the UAE’s journey towards a healthier, safer and more sustainable future.
